eCurrency Transaction
3c186f4b76482aa093902d643cf300165d98276aeb12dabe0bf86c31d544734b
2024-11-28 15:00:05
Transaction info
Amount transacted
17 712.34858788 ECRFees
0.0 ECRReceived
6 months agoConfirmations
CompleteAdvanced Details
Details
1 Inputs Consumed
- 17 712.34858788 Output ERmoRD7BvcphDJaYRwRHRmrzVVn5LNpPBG
2 Outputs Created
- 130.8 Unspent EVvK4AybSa6nSjNWPPJqwXDwuQDVcoe4LZ
- 17 581.54858788 Spent ES4CT4qr1jgRsN8R2vQkznXmqMYQ5XZbVT